About The Position

The Sales Manager is the main point of contact between Mexilink’s brands and its clients. You will oversee client relations to increase sales by developing business plans, meeting planned goals, and coordinating with our merchandising team for a variety of activities within the region.

Responsibilities

  • Compiles lists of prospective customers for use as sales leads, based on information from newspapers, business directories, industry ads, trade shows, Internet Web sites, and other sources.
  • Builds and maintains client relations.
  • Meets and exceeds KPIs and sales targets.
  • Generates reports to track sales and goals.
  • Travels throughout assigned territory to call on regular and prospective customers to solicit orders or talk with customers on sales floor or by phone.
  • Possess deep knowledge of business products offering a value proposition.
  • Displays or demonstrates product, using samples or catalog, and emphasizes sellable features.
  • Quotes prices and credit terms and prepares sales contracts for orders obtained.
  • Estimates date of delivery to customer, based on knowledge of own firm's production and delivery schedules.
  • Prepares reports of business transactions and keeps expense accounts.
  • Works with inside and outside sales representatives to keep account activities and literature up to date.
  • Tracks stock levels.
  • Coordinates customer training.
  • Enters new customer data and other sales data for current customers into computer database.
  • Develops and maintains relationships with purchasing contacts.
  • Investigates and resolves customer problems.
  • Attends trade shows.
  • Proactively pursues new business and sales opportunities.
